2009 “The Best of Texas Longhorn & Heifer Sale”Terms and Conditions Of Sale

Bidding: Each animal will be sold to the highest bidder with reserve.

Bidding Disputes: The auctioneer in charge will settle any disputes as to bids, and his decision on such matters shall be final.

Terms: The terms of the sale are cash or check to the clerk at the conclusion of the auction. Checks are to be made payable to TLBGCA.

Possession: Immediately after the animal is sold, it will be the sole risk and responsibility of the buyer thereof, but possession can not be obtained until payment is made.

Certificates: A Certification of Registration will be furnished and transferred to the purchaser on each lot in the sale, excluding calves at side.

Health: Individual state health requirements should be considered by bidders before purchasing.

Breeding Guarantee: All animals sold are guaranteed breeders by their owners. Females in calf, or with calf at side, are considered breeders without further guarantee. Breeder guarantees are strictly between the individual consignor and the purchaser at the sale. Fertility tested bulls and females vet checked safe with calf will be announced at sale time. All sucking calves are given to the purchaser free and carry no guarantee.

Notice: The TLBGCA is merely acting as an agent in this sale and is not responsible in any manner for any representation made by the seller. The purchaser must look to the seller for fulfillment of all guarantees and representations made hereunder.

Pedigrees: The information on the pedigree listed herein has been furnished by the seller.

Announcements: Any announcements made from the auction box will take precedence over the printed matter in this catalogue and all other announcements.

Buyer Responsibility: Prospective buyers/bidders at the sale should listen carefully to all announcements from the auction box by the auctioneer, pedigree reader or seller on each animal that is sold. It is the buyer/bidder’s responsibility to acquaint themselves with the terms concerning the breeding status, fertility, and health papers of the animals being sold. It is the sole responsibility of the buyer/bidder to be aware of health regulations for transportation of animals into their state of residence. By doing so, a buyer/bidder can prevent any problems or misunderstandings and will enable him or herself to be a more competent and qualified bidder.

Liabilities: All persons who attend the sale do so at their own risk. The TLBGCA and it’s officers assume no liability, legal or otherwise, for any accidents or thefts that may occur.

Load Out: 30 minutes after the conclusion of the sale until 10:00 p.m. on Saturday, and until 10:00 a.m. on Sunday.

Contract: The above terms and conditions shall constitute a contract between the buyer and seller of each animal sold. The TLBGCA and it’s officers assume no liability, legal or otherwise, for any other representation between the buyer and the seller.
